How OpenAI let a mob of LLM agents game a test and ransack Hugging Face
The OpenAI agents involved in last month’s incursion into Hugging Face were trained so heavily on winning a competition that they pursued a relentless campaign to cheat, a new report documented. In the process, and without authorization, they created an improvised message board to hatch a plan that ultimately landed them squarely inside the latter company’s network. Over the course of May and June, OpenAI gave the agents what the company described as “impossible tasks” to complete on the benchmarking framework ExploitGym.
